That's what I thought re the writing functionality - and, three months later, I hardly do any reading at all!

I have done so many puzzles (I send them to my Scribe each morning from The Times UK), and last year I started learning coding, and I've starting using the notebooks for this all the time - something I never envisaged at all. But the writing feels so nice, especially with the new fountain pen, that it is a great way for me to keep my notes organized in one place instead of in various paper notebooks that I never pick up after use (and just end up cluttering my house up).
I purchased a great notebook template on Etsy (goes into the PDFs of the Library section, not Notebooks) and it has a contents page, plus a section list for each section, so it has a kind of organizational tree within the notebook. It's really keeping my complicated notes organized.
I also bought a weekly planner template from Etsy which is easily replacing my Filofax - although I am still noting down my projects, PO and invoice details on the paper copy for my tax records. I don't fully trust the kindle to keep my business records safe.
I love this device, but I did not predict that it would pretty much stop me reading.
